feat(bd-grs): implement app navigation with keyboard shortcuts

Add navigation with keyboard shortcuts (Cmd+1/2/3/4/,) for Focus, Queue, Inbox, Debug, and Settings views.

Components:
- useKeyboardShortcuts hook: handles global shortcuts with editable element detection
- Navigation component: standalone nav bar (not used, but available)
- SettingsView placeholder: Phase 5 stub
- AppShell: integrated keyboard shortcuts and Settings button

Tests:
- useKeyboardShortcuts: 11 tests covering shortcuts, modifiers, editable detection
- Navigation: 12 tests covering nav items, badges, click, keyboard shortcuts

/**
* useKeyboardShortcuts - Global keyboard shortcut handler
*
* Provides a declarative way to register keyboard shortcuts that work
* across the entire app. Supports mod+key format where "mod" maps to
* Cmd on Mac and Ctrl on other platforms.
*
* Ignores shortcuts when typing in input fields, textareas, or contenteditable.
*/
import { useEffect, useCallback } from "react";
/**
* Map of shortcut patterns to handlers.
*
* Pattern format: "mod+<key>" where mod = Cmd (Mac) or Ctrl (other)
* Examples: "mod+1", "mod+,", "mod+k"
*/
export type ShortcutMap = Record<string, () => void>;
/**
* Check if an element is editable (input, textarea, contenteditable)
*/
function isEditableElement(element: Element | null): boolean {
if (!element) return false;
const tagName = element.tagName.toLowerCase();
if (tagName === "input" || tagName === "textarea") {
return true;
}
if (element instanceof HTMLElement) {
// Check multiple ways (browser vs JSDOM compatibility):
// - isContentEditable (browser property)
// - contentEditable property (works in JSDOM when set via property)
// - getAttribute (works when set via setAttribute)
if (
element.isContentEditable ||
element.contentEditable === "true" ||
element.getAttribute("contenteditable") === "true"
) {
return true;
}
}
return false;
}
/**
* Check if the event originated from an editable element
*/
function isFromEditableElement(event: KeyboardEvent): boolean {
// Check event target first (where the event originated)
if (event.target instanceof Element && isEditableElement(event.target)) {
return true;
}
// Also check activeElement as fallback
return isEditableElement(document.activeElement);
}
/**
* Parse a shortcut pattern and check if it matches the keyboard event.
*/
function matchesShortcut(pattern: string, event: KeyboardEvent): boolean {
const parts = pattern.toLowerCase().split("+");
const key = parts.pop();
const modifiers = new Set(parts);
// Check if key matches
if (event.key.toLowerCase() !== key) {
return false;
}
// "mod" means Cmd on Mac, Ctrl elsewhere
const hasModModifier = modifiers.has("mod");
if (hasModModifier) {
// Accept either metaKey (Cmd) or ctrlKey (Ctrl)
if (!event.metaKey && !event.ctrlKey) {
return false;
}
}
return true;
}
/**
* Hook to register global keyboard shortcuts.
*
* @param shortcuts - Map of shortcut patterns to handler functions
*
* @example
* useKeyboardShortcuts({
* "mod+1": () => setView("focus"),
* "mod+2": () => setView("queue"),
* "mod+,": () => setView("settings"),
* });
*/
export function useKeyboardShortcuts(shortcuts: ShortcutMap): void {
const handleKeyDown = useCallback(
(event: KeyboardEvent) => {
// Don't handle shortcuts when typing in an editable element
if (isFromEditableElement(event)) {
return;
}
for (const [pattern, handler] of Object.entries(shortcuts)) {
if (matchesShortcut(pattern, event)) {
event.preventDefault();
handler();
return;
}
}
},
[shortcuts]
);
useEffect(() => {
document.addEventListener("keydown", handleKeyDown);
return () => {
document.removeEventListener("keydown", handleKeyDown);
};
}, [handleKeyDown]);
}
